Medical Coder Job Description

Chandler Arizona patient medical history

Medical coders work on the front line of the billing systems for Chandler AZ private practices and hospitals. Coders have the responsibility to examine the medical records of patients and convert all services provided into universal codes. These services can be for diagnosis, medical or dental procedures, or any equipment or medical supplies used. There are several codes that are utilized in this conversion process, including the following:

  • CPT codes (Current Procedural Terminology).
  • ICD codes (International Classification of Diseases).
  • HCPCS codes (Healthcare Common Procedure Coding).

Medical coders depend on information from sources including nursing and physician notes, patient charts, and lab and radiology reports. Medical Coders must not only know what services were provided in total for accuracy, but must have a functioning knowledge of all government and private payer rules that affect coding as well. Improperly coded claims can lead to services not being paid for, services being paid for at a lower rate, or the physician or facility being penalized for fraudulent or improper billing. Since improper coding can literally cost Chandler AZ doctors and hospitals multiple thousands of dollars in revenue each year, a proficient medical coder is a vital asset to the healthcare team. They can operate in every kind of healthcare facility, including private practices, clinics, hospitals and critical care centers. It is not uncommon for professional medical coders to working from home as an independent contractor or offsite employee.

Medical Biller Job Functions

Chandler Arizona health insurance forms

As important as the medical coder's role is, it would be for naught without the contribution of the medical biller whose labors bring in revenue. Medical billing clerks are very important to Chandler AZ medical organizations and are literally responsible for keeping their doors open. Often the biller and coder are the same man or woman within a medical organization, but they can also be two individual professionals. Once the coder has completed his or her duty, the biller utilizes the codes provided to fill out and submit claim forms to insurance carriers, Medicare or Medicaid. After they have been adjusted by the appropriate organization, patients can then be invoiced for deductibles and additional out of pocket expenses. On a routine basis, a medical biller might also do any of the following:

  • Verify health insurance benefits for patients and assist them with billing questions or concerns
  • Follow up on submitted patient claims and appeal any that have been declined
  • Act as an intermediary between the medical provider, the insurance carriers and the patients for accurate claim settlement
  • Generate and oversee Accounts Receivables reports
  • Create and take care of unpaid patient collections accounts

Medical billing clerks not only are employed by family practices, but also Chandler AZ hospitals, urgent care facilities, nursing homes or medical groups. They may work in any type of medical facility that relies on the incomes generated from billing patients and third party payers.

Medical Billing and Coding Online Education and Certification

cash under stethoscope Chandler ArizonaIt's imperative that you receive your instruction from a reputable school, whether it's a technical school, vocational school or community college. Although it is not required in most cases to attain a professional certification, the school you select should be accredited (more on the advantages of accreditation later). The majority of Arizona schools only require that you earn either a high school diploma or a GED to be eligible. The most expedient way to become either a medical biller or coder (or both) is to earn a certificate, which usually takes about one year to complete. An Associate Degree is also an option for a more extensive education, which for almost all schools requires two years of studies. Bachelor's Degrees for medical billing and coding are not abundantly available. After your education has been completed, although not required in the majority of states, you might wish to acquire a professional certification. Certification is an effective way for those new to the field to show potential employers that they are not only qualified but dedicated to their career. Some of the organizations that offer certifications are:

  • American Academy of Professional Coders (AAPC).
  • Board of Medical Specialty Coding (BMSC).
  • The Professional Association of Healthcare Coding Specialists (PAHCS).
  • American Health Information Management Association (AHIMA).

Graduating from an accredited medical billing and coding course, in conjunction with obtaining a professional certification, are the best ways to accelerate your new vocation and succeed in the rapid growing healthcare field.
